1

Например, в приложении есть кнопка, при нажатии на которую открывается диалоговое окно "Открыть файл".
При первом использовании кнопки диалоговое окно приведет вас к пути по умолчанию. скорее всего "Мои документы".
Но последующие щелчки ведут вас по пути, который вы посещали в прошлый раз, даже если само приложение не обрабатывает это вообще (я пробовал это с приложением .NET WinForm в 1 строку). Таким образом, ОС должна поддерживать информацию о "последнем использованном пути" для приложений.
Поэтому мне интересно, где Windows хранит эту информацию?
Если я хочу стереть эту информацию, как мне это сделать?

1 ответ1

1

Пожалуйста, попробуйте следующий реестр Windows (regedit). Не испытано.

XP

H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\Comdlg32\LastVisitedMRU

Vista, Win7, Win8, Win10

HKCU\Software\Microsoft\Windows\CurrentVersion\Explorer\Comdlg32\LastVisitedPidlMRU

Источник: http://www.forensicswiki.org/wiki/LastVisitedMRU

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.